Why Arcadia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Arcadia's housing mix ranges from historic downtown homes built in the early 1900s to newer ranch-style properties and manufactured homes scattered throughout the area. Each type comes with its own garage door challenges. Older homes often have undersized doors or outdated hardware that needs careful replacement planning. Newer construction typically features standard two-car doors, but Florida's humidity still takes its toll on springs and openers.

The weather here creates specific problems. Summer heat makes metal components expand, while sudden afternoon thunderstorms bring moisture that accelerates rust. Springs lose tension faster in high humidity. Most residential springs last around 7 to 9 years in our climate, not the 10 years you'll see advertised for northern states. We've replaced countless springs throughout Arcadia neighborhoods where homeowners didn't realize the coils had weakened until the door wouldn't lift.

Cable fraying is another common issue we see across the 34269 and 34266 ZIP codes. The combination of daily use and moisture causes cables to develop weak spots. When one snaps, the door becomes dangerously unbalanced. That's why we recommend annual inspections, especially for doors over five years old.

What's the most common problem you see in Arcadia?

Broken torsion springs account for about 40% of our Arcadia service calls. The combination of daily use and Florida humidity causes metal fatigue faster than in drier climates. We also see a lot of opener failures in doors that face west, since the afternoon sun heats up the motor housing and shortens the lifespan. Parking in shade or adding ventilation helps, but eventually all openers need replacement.
